//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Gets the current watchdog timer value.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//!
//! This function reads the current value of the watchdog timer.
//!
//! \return Returns the current value of the watchdog timer.
//
//*****************************************************************************
unsigned long
WatchdogValueGet(unsigned long ulBase)
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Get the current watchdog timer register value.
//
return(HWREG(ulBase + WDT_O_VALUE));
}
//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Registers an interrupt.handler for watchdog timer interrupt.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//! \param pfnHandler is a pointer to the function to be called when the
//! watchdog timer interrupt occurs.
//!
//! This function does the actual registering of the interrupt.handler. This
//! will enable the global interrupt in the interrupt controller; the watchdog
//! timer interrupt must be enabled via WatchdogEnable(). It is the interrupt
//! handler's responsibility to clear the interrupt source via
//! WatchdogIntClear().
//!
//! \sa IntRegister() for important information about registering interrupt
//! handlers.
//!
//! \return None.
//
//*****************************************************************************
void
WatchdogIntRegister(unsigned long ulBase, void (*pfnHandler)(void))
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Register the interrupt.handler.
//
IntRegister(INT_WATCHDOG, pfnHandler);
//
// Enable the watchdog timer interrupt.
//
IntEnable(INT_WATCHDOG);
}
//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Unregisters an interrupt.handler for the watchdog timer interrupt.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//!
//! This function does the actual unregistering of the interrupt.handler. This
//! function will clear the handler to be called when a watchdog timer
//! interrupt occurs. This will also mask off the interrupt in the interrupt
//! controller so that the interrupt.handler no longer is called.
//!
//! \sa IntRegister() for important information about registering interrupt
//! handlers.
//!
//! \return None.
//
//*****************************************************************************
void
WatchdogIntUnregister(unsigned long ulBase)
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Disable the interrupt.
//
IntDisable(INT_WATCHDOG);
//
// Unregister the interrupt.handler.
//
IntUnregister(INT_WATCHDOG);
}
//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Enables the watchdog timer interrupt.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//!
//! Enables the watchdog timer interrupt.
//!
//! \note This function will have no effect if the watchdog timer has
//! been locked.
//!
//! \sa WatchdogLock(), WatchdogUnlock(), WatchdogEnable()
//!
//! \return None.
//
//*****************************************************************************
void
WatchdogIntEnable(unsigned long ulBase)
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Enable the watchdog interrupt.
//
HWREG(ulBase + WDT_O_CTL) |= WDT_CTL_INTEN;
}
//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Gets the current watchdog timer interrupt status.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//! \param bMasked is \b false if the raw interrupt status is required and
//! \b true if the masked interrupt status is required.
//!
//! This returns the interrupt status for the watchdog timer module. Either
//! the raw interrupt status or the status of interrupt that is allowed to
//! reflect to the processor can be returned.
//!
//! \return The current interrupt status, where a 1 indicates that the watchdog
//! interrupt is active, and a 0 indicates that it is not active.
//
//*****************************************************************************
unsigned long
WatchdogIntStatus(unsigned long ulBase, tBoolean bMasked)
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Return either the interrupt status or the raw interrupt status as
// requested.
//
if(bMasked)
{
return(HWREG(ulBase + WDT_O_MIS));
}
else
{
return(HWREG(ulBase + WDT_O_RIS));
}
}
//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Clears the watchdog timer interrupt.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//!
//! The watchdog timer interrupt source is cleared, so that it no longer
//! asserts.
//!
//! \return None.
//
//*****************************************************************************
void
WatchdogIntClear(unsigned long ulBase)
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Clear the interrupt source.
//
HWREG(ulBase + WDT_O_ICR) = WDT_INT_TIMEOUT;
}
//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Enables stalling of the watchdog timer during debug events.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//!
//! This function allows the watchdog timer to stop counting when the processor
//! is stopped by the debugger. By doing so, the watchdog is prevented from
//! expiring (typically almost immediately from a human time perspective) and
//! resetting the system (if reset is enabled). The watchdog will instead
//! expired after the appropriate number of processor cycles have been executed
//! while debugging (or at the appropriate time after the processor has been
//! restarted).
//!
//! \return None.
//
//*****************************************************************************
void
WatchdogStallEnable(unsigned long ulBase)
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Enable timer stalling.
//
HWREG(ulBase + WDT_O_TEST) |= WDT_TEST_STALL;
}
//*****************************************************************************
//
//! Disables stalling of the watchdog timer during debug events.
//!
//! \param ulBase is the base address of the watchdog timer module.
//!
//! This function disables the debug mode stall of the watchdog timer. By
//! doing so, the watchdog timer continues to count regardless of the processor
//! debug state.
//!
//! \return None.
//
//*****************************************************************************
void
WatchdogStallDisable(unsigned long ulBase)
{
//
// Check the arguments.
//
ASSERT(ulBase == WATCHDOG_BASE);
//
// Disable timer stalling.
//
HWREG(ulBase + WDT_O_TEST) &= ~(WDT_TEST_STALL);
}
